Eventually, I found my way back to the safe sections of the cave.
I collapsed instantly and fell unconscious the moment I recognised my surroundings for what they were.
I had done everything I possibly could.
Day 6
I’ve lost count of how many slimes I’ve killed.
The first thing I did after eating was to go to the merchant and buy a new sword.
It was almost exactly the same as the previous one but it was somewhat longer and heavier.
Thankfully this one had a sheath and belt so I wouldn’t need to lug it around like a videogame character.
I also purchased a sewing kit. Besides the main essentials… well, my clothes were the only thing from Earth I really owned. I wasn’t going to lose them so easily.
I headed back and took a while repairing my clothes and getting accustomed to the new blade.
I almost died yesterday. That absolutely cannot happen again.
I will not allow myself to suffer such a humiliating defeat a second time, against the same type of opponent.
I need more creative ways to fight. I’m also not going to take a risk like going to the second floor again.
Not yet.
I need to be stronger. So that they wouldn’t even be able to touch me.
The fights with normal slimes is basically a game to me now. I need more power.
Enough that the slime hand becomes an insect against my foot.
So what if I rethink how I use my magic?
I thought of fireball exploding so it created the burst variation.
What if I reduce the scale of that? Make it smaller?
Then use it for something besides a frontal magical attack?
What if I use it to enhance my physical capabilities?
I head down to the lower sections of the cave and find a crowd of slimes.
Advertisement
I picture it in my head. An explosion. A small one. Like a rocket filled with fireworks.
Then minimise it. A blast with kinetic force but minimal burning effect.
That’s step one.
Second, I’ve got to apply it to my sword.
As if the ball of fire in my mind is a rocket attached to the weapon I wield.
It’s a flicker away from detonation.
When it happens it’ll send my blade flying forward at unimaginable speeds and thus with increased power.
Instead of firing flames at my enemies, I’ll use its propulsion in the opposite direction to move.
I will turn my sword into a bullet for a fraction of a second!
I approach a slime and stretch out my left arm.
It leaps towards it. I drop my left arm. The creature is midair.
It won’t be able to dodge this. I swing my sword back with just my right arm as if it were a racket of some kind… and then I slash with all my muscles can muster.
The moment I can feel a downward shift in the momentum of my slash, I know that’s the time to test my theory.
“Fireball: Burst!” I hear the roaring for an engine for half a second and then a popping blossom of fire.
My right arm is filled with power and weight like it had never known before.
The velocity of my attack is blindingly fast!
For a second I see my sword coated in red heat.
It incinerates all of the slime's body from merely being in close proximity.
Melting away like foie gras on a hot plate.
Then the slash finishes properly.
The core is cleaved clean.
Success.
This attack is faster and stronger.
It’s certainly overkill to use on a single slime but it’s good to know what I’m capable of.
Advertisement
It didn’t feel particularly taxing mana wise but my right arm does feel a small tingle from the shockwave of the swing. Still, if I want the best results from my training… well, now I can both use magic and a physical move at the same time. That certainly will improve both attributes.
You’ve obtained a new technique - Explosive Edge.
Now comes the fun part.
I begin to comb the first floor from top to bottom.
Through every nook and cranny.
I hunt the slimes with efficiency and proficiency like never before.
Each and every one of them tastes the force of my explosive edge.
I cut them down one after another without even less difficulty than before.
Until I had cleaned the first floor of their presence entirely.

I headed towards the floor of the second stairs.
I felt pretty tired from the expedition today but I had to know something.
I opened the red vial from the bag of supplies I had gotten on my first day.
I chugged it down. It had the consistency of ketchup but with the bubbles of a soda.
It tasted like cherries.
I felt my heart pound like a war drum.
My body began to instantly felt re-energised.
As if I had drunk a red bull but it kicked in the moment it touched my lips.
I waited with my sword drawn at the top of the stairs.
I simply stood there for hours absentmindedly swinging my sword in succession.
After what felt like half a day… they appeared.
A horde of slimes that slowly dragged their gelatinous bodies up the stairs without a single thought.
I found myself grinning while my mind was brimming with curiosity.
So they do restock themselves.
I have no idea if the Slime Royalty that was making them was intelligent in any way but these things are like territorial vermin.
They march back to reclaim what is theirs.
Excellent. I can stay around here and be completely safe.
Only the fodder comes this way.
They sense me. They leap. I rip them into nothingness.
Over and over again. Ceaselessly until my body was once again at the breaking point.
I drank another red flask and continued. I would not know defeat against fools of this caliber.
Creatures that can only march onwards, without nothing in their brains but how to serve their master.
Just like…!
“You shall not pass!”
I’ve always wanted to say that.
My blade dances through the air, fuelled by my fury.
Until the stairs smelt like smoke. Until the critters completely stopped coming.
